(III) Determine a formula for the average power dissipated in an LRC circuit in terms of L, R, C, ω and V0. Find an approximate formula for the width of the resonance peak in average power, Δω, which is the difference in the two (angular) frequencies where has half its maximum value. Assume a sharp peak.
